比特币作为世界上第一个去中心化的数字货币,自2009年问世以来,已经引起了全球范围内的关注和讨论。伴随着比特币的迅速普及,区块链技术也逐渐被大众熟知。作为比特币的基础设施,区块链技术不仅仅是支撑比特币交易的背后体系,更是引发了对新的金融模型、创新商业模式等方面的探索。而在这一过程中,区块链运行终端的应用和发展也呈现出多元化的趋势。本文将深入探讨比特币区块链运行终端的功能、使用方法、相关知识和在未来可能面临的挑战。
比特币区块链运行终端是指运行并维护比特币网络的节点程序。区块链的每一个节点都在存储和验证交易信息,并参与生成新区块。节点可以是全节点,也可以是轻节点。
全节点负责维护整个区块链的数据,保证网络的去中心化与安全性。轻节点则只下载区块链的一部分信息,且主要依赖全节点进行交易的验证。这些节点共同构成了比特币网络,使得交易达到确认并维持网络的安全性。
比特币区块链运行终端的功能多种多样,以下是其主要功能:
对于想要参与比特币网络的用户来说,设置和使用区块链运行终端是个重要的步骤。下面是基本的步骤指导:
此外,用户也可以通过设置一些参数,例如连接的节点数、带宽限制等,来运行终端的性能。
尽管比特币区块链运行终端为用户提供了许多便利,但在实际应用中也面临着各种挑战。主要包括:
为了克服这些挑战,用户可以选择与更高效的节点合作,或是考虑使用轻节点来降低资源消耗。
比特币区块链运行终端在未来的发展方向可能包括:
选择合适的比特币区块链运行终端软件,这往往取决于用户的需求、对技术的理解程度及计算机性能。
通常情况下,比特币核心软件(Bitcoin Core)是最受欢迎的选择,因为它是由比特币社区官方维护的,并且功能强大。然而,对于那些不需要全节点功能的用户来说,轻节点软件可能是更佳的选择,能够节省更多的系统资源。
其次,用户还可以考虑软件的兼容性。例如,有些软件可能在特定的操作系统上运行得更好,如Windows或Linux。
维护与管理区块链节点,需要定期关注节点的运行状况和软件版本。首先,用户应定期检查软件更新,确保节点具有最新的功能和安全补丁。
其次,节点运行者应该使用可靠的互联网连接,以防中断或数据传输不稳定带来的影响。此外,为了提高节点的安全性,用户还应考虑使用防火墙以及其他安全措施,以防止潜在的网络攻击。
最后,监控节点的性能指标,如CPU使用率、内存利用率等,也是确保节点平稳运行的重要方法。
运行比特币区块链终端的成本主要包括硬件成本、网络费用和电力费用。
硬件成本方面,全节点通常需要一台配置良好的计算机,具备足够的内存和存储空间(至少几百GB)。一些用户可能会选择专用的矿机或运行在云服务器上,这也涉及到额外的硬件投入。
网络费用是指用户维护节点所需的互联网费用。节点需要稳定、高速的连接,网络流量的消耗通常取决于节点的活跃程度。为了良好的性能,用户应优先选择不限流量的套餐。
最后,电力成本也是需要考虑的一部分。长时间运行节点可能会产生较高的电力费用,尤其是在电价较高的地区。为此,用户可以考虑在低谷电量时段运行节点,从而降低功耗。
比特币交易的安全性可以通过以下几方面来保证:
比特币全节点与轻节点的主要区别在于它们处理和存储数据的方式及其在网络中的作用。
全节点会下载整个区块链并维护所有交易记录,这意味着它们在确保网络安全性和去中心化方面发挥着重要作用。使用全节点的用户可以自主验证交易,提高隐私性和安全性。
而轻节点只下载必要的交易信息,并依赖全节点来确认交易。这使得轻节点占用的存储空间和计算资源较少,因此更适合资源有限的用户,但相比之下,其安全性和隐私性也会有所降低。
参与比特币社区并为区块链网络贡献的方式有很多。用户可以通过运行全节点,参与网络交易与验证,从而增强网络的安全性。
同样,用户也可以通过参与讨论、撰写文章和博客,分享自己的使用经验,帮助他人理解比特币及区块链技术。通过这些贡献,用户不仅能够增强自己的知识,也能服务于更广泛的比特币社区。
此外,用户也可以参与开发开源软件项目,为比特币生态系统的发展创新提供支持,从而成为区块链网络中的重要参与者。
综上所述,比特币区块链运行终端是连接用户与数字货币世界的重要桥梁。了解与掌握相关知识,能够使用户更好地参与到这个充满潜力的领域中去。
2003-2024 tokenim钱包最新版 @版权所有